Gitty Up for this Wild Bronco

Wild Bronco

Get ready for this action packed thriller with non stop drops, turns and surprises. Located in the Old West Section, this new coaster for 2007 was designed to fit into the compact site and crosses over its own track several times. It features a 99 foot first drop, several moments of "airtime" and is a high speed ride the whole way through. This wooden twister coaster runs 2 PTC trains of 24 passengers and has a theoretical capacity of 1035pph.

Ride Fact Sheet:

Opening: January 26
Height: 105.97 feet
Drop: 98.75 feet
Top Speed: 53 mph
Capactiy: 1035 pph
Trains: 2 PTC Trains (24 passengers)
